Merge branch 'for-linus' of git://git.kernel.org/pub/scm/linux/kernel/git/ebiederm/user-namespace
Pull namespace fix from Eric Biederman: "This has a single brown bag fix. The possible deadlock with dec_pid_namespaces that I had thought was fixed earlier turned out only to have been moved. So instead of being cleaver this change takes ucounts_lock with irqs disabled. So dec_ucount can be used from any context without fear of deadlock. The items accounted for dec_ucount and inc_ucount are all comparatively heavy weight objects so I don't exepct this will have any measurable performance impact" * 'for-linus' of git://git.kernel.org/pub/scm/linux/kernel/git/ebiederm/user-namespace: userns: Make ucounts lock irq-safe
